That's beautiful! I love how you have the cabinets underneath - that would be perfect for snake stuff storage!

The only thing is I see you have thermometers on the back which are measuring ambient temperature. Do you also have one on the bottom on the viv? I usually keep one there because corn snakes care more about belly heat than air heat.

Great job again! I'm a little bit jealous of what a beautiful stand your snake gets! I'm sure she loves it.
 
I actually have THG Heat tape under the the warm side, and I have a Ranco thermostat regulating the temperature. It's a decent setup.
